Im not worried about this but if she didnt then I would be. My female Henlei every times she is prego goes up the back of the tank, sucks in water and spits it out of the tank. Ive been hit with water as far as 6 feet away and she soaks the wall. Anyone ever seen or heard of something like this?
 
That is such a cool behavior; it has been observed from Potamotrygon scobina by researchers. Get it on video!

I've gone to the fridge in the morning and my leopoldi/pearl crossbred ray clung to the side of the tank and hit me with a jet of water from about 6' away. I would assume that he recognized the light and then saw me walk past without feeding him. Rays can have quite the personalities.

she is hungry, reasearchers noticed this type of behavior before and linked it back to when the rays wanted food
 
its normal every ray i have had spits water

they go to the back glass were the filter pipes are and spit water out the side of the pipes
